This Day In NCHSAA History

December 2, 1989 On this day in history in the NCHSAA, Landrie McDuffie of Lumberton recorded the fastest fall in NCHSAA wrestling history and currently shares the national mark for his weight class when he pinned his opponent in just three seconds.

This Day In NCHSAA History

November 28, 1969 On this day in history in the NCHSAA, Wilson’s Fike High School won its third straight North Carolina High School Athletic Association state 4-A football championship by defeating Winston-Salem Atkins 17-10 at Bowman Gray Stadium in Winston-Salem.
